Four Seasons Equestrian Arts Center is a 36 acre horse facility open for boarding, training, and lessons located in Crawford County, PA. Four Seasons is the culmination of a lifelong passion for horses and riding, a love for teaching and learning, and a desire to bring people with the same love and fascination for horses together. Our main barn is a 1991 Morton stable featuring a 72x135 indoor riding arena and a 100x230 fenced all-weather outdoor riding arena. Inside the main stable is a 26 stall equine facility with two stall sides, hot and cold water wash stall, heated feed room, 12x22 remodeled office with restroom facilities, and two tack rooms. Outside we feature 4 turn out pastures, 2 run-in sheds, each with 2, 14x16 stalls, electricity, frost-free hydrants, and 4 individual attached paddocks with 5 stranded hot wire. Four Seasons is home to all breeds, ages and disciplines.

We are pleased to announce the introduction of the Miniature Horse Class to our lineup of approved weekend show classes.

This new class aims to provide a competitive platform for miniature horses and their riders, promoting inclusivity and diversity within the sport of cutting.

This addition reflects NCHA's commitment to evolving the sport and providing opportunities for all equine athletes and enthusiasts.

Your horse doesn’t need you to be perfect

In fact, the pursuit of your perfectionism just might be the main thing holding you back from a successful relationship with your horse.

β€œPerfectionism is often defined as the pursuit of flawless performance or outcomes, accompanied by critical self-evaluation and harsh self-criticism.”
- Hritz N

You see, perfectionism is rooted in a fear of failure. And when you are working with your horse, fretting about the future (fearing you will fail, and putting extra stress on yourself to be sure you are doing it perfectly), you are not present. What your horse desires the most to feel safe is a present minded, stable individual. One that’s predictable in there energy when with them. Horses don’t have large pre frontal cortex’s, which is the part of the brain for humans, used for organizing, planning, perfecting, manipulating, ect. While they do have a small one, it functions differently than ours. So when we get stuck in it, they just don’t really understand it. They rely heavily, however, on memory. Each time your with them their memory of the event before and the β€œfeeling” they had with you is strong.
There is power in being present, and grounded when working with your horse. More power in that than you being overly focused, stuck in the thinking part of your brain in order to be β€˜perfect’. While a small amount of perfectionism can be good to keep you striving for better, we have to work hard to β€œget out of that space” when you are working with your horse.

While getting better is always the goal, and learning to ask with better technique is great, we can’t get stuck in the loop of perfectionism which leads to the anxiety of failing due to over self evaluation, and fear that we won’t be able to ever to do it our own standards. Take relief in knowing your horse isn’t asking you to be perfect, you are the only one doing that. I’ve seen some of the most incredible bonds and relationships created with imperfect riders.
